Replace Obsolete Assumptions

His basic premise is that we need to replace outdated assumptions with the “Rules of the New Rich” and enjoy life now.

Online Businesses need to replace limiting assumptions and their owners need to learn how to enjoy life now. We need to be able to manage our businesses, and our lives, from anywhere, anytime.

The New Rich (NR) believe that time and mobility are the most precious commodities.

Rules of the New Rich

According to Ferris, the “Rules of the New Rich” include the following:

  • Retirement is Worst-Case Scenario Insurance
  • Interest and Energy are Cyclical
  • Less is Not Laziness
  • The Timing Is Never Right
  • Ask for Forgiveness, Not Permission
  • Emphasize Strengths, Don’t Fix Weaknesses
  • Things in Excess Become the Opposite
  • Money Alone is Not the Solution
  • Relative Income is More Important than Absolute Income
  • Distress is Bad, Eustress is Good

The 4HWW Model

His model provides us with a roadmap for realizing our own lifelong dreams. He shows us how to:

  • Live like a millionaire
  • Free time and automate income
  • Outsource our lives to overseas virtual assistants for $5/hour
  • Travel the world without quitting our jobs
  • Eliminate 50% of our work in 48 hours
  • Trade a long-haul career for short work bursts and mini-retirements

He uses the DEAL acronym to describe his model, where:

  • D = Definition
  • E = Elimination
  • A = Automation
  • L = Liberation

He encourages us to use “Dreamlining” to design our own luxurious lifestyles. We need to focus our current efforts on elimination, simplification and outsourcing if we want to find ourselves among the New Rich (NR).

Ferriss’ 4 Hour Workweek model relies upon the Lifestyle Design (LD) process including both art and science. Another key component of the lifestyle design process is automation, i.e., building a system to replace ourselves as bottlenecks. But never automate something that could be eliminated, and never delegate something that could be automated or simplified.
